USC is a 22-point favorite on the road according to oddsmakers from online sports book SBGGLOBAL.com. The over/under has been set at 56.
USC has been hard to figure out this season as they have played to the level of their competition. Offensively, they have averaged 420 yards per-game but they are giving up 411 yards per-game on defense, including 291 through the air. Washington State is among one of the worst teams in college football, but their offense is respectable, as the Cougars post 233 passing yards per-game.
Some trends to consider with this pick: USC is 0-2 against the spread this season and 3-10 ATS in road games since 2008. The Trojans are also just 6-12 ATS against conference opponents.
With this game taking place at home and USC struggling in the secondary, we suggest a pick of Washington State to cover the point spread odds.
